Taking another shot at the Wyoming Risk today, I have no doubt the SE Nebraska and NE Kansas risk will light up with big Supercells but if we can get some organised Supercells in Eastern Wyoming we could be in business with large hail and the possibility of a brief Tornado or Landspout, temps over here struggling to hit the High 60's with 50f Dewpoints and around 1,000jkg of Cape whereas further east 3,000jkg of Cape. Could not stomach the 400 mile drive to get into position and that's even before chasing. Dropping South tomorrow for a hopeful risk in SE Colorado.

Here's an interesting discussion of heat bursts that occurred earlier on Thursday in the plains states.

http://www.americanwx.com/bb/index.php/topic/19929-rare-heat-burst-hits-wichitaks/

(if you're not a member of this forum, you may not see all graphics posted)

Basically, a heat burst is usually nocturnal and a blast of heat from within a decaying thunderstorm. These sometimes raise temperatures from the 70s or low 80s F to 95-105 F briefly.
